Obituary for Lawrence Lamont Kynard Sr.

Lawrence Lamont Kynard Sr., age 52, passed away suddenly. He graduated from Macomber Whitney Vocational School in 1984. He was an outstanding football athletic. His last job was with the Toledo Sanitarian Department. He was a father, brother, grandfather, uncle and friend to many.

At an early age he was baptized at his grandparents church, Shiloh Baptist Church. He was at peace with himself in life and reassured us/family that everything was ok. He called us all, his family and friends, to talk about life and love. He never hung up the phone nor said goodbye without proclaiming his love. He was a skilled welder. He loved to play dominoes, listen to music and drink his beers.

He was preceded in death by his brother Damond V. Kynard. He leaves to cherish his memory: his three daughters Lonyae Kynard, Erin Kynard and Pearlia Ann Kynard; two step-daughters Terri and Nicki; two sons Kurtis Jeffery Kynard and Lawrence L. Kynard Jr.; three step-sons Mark, Junior and Tommy; six grandchildren; six nieces and three nephews; two brothers Erik Kynard (Davette) and Aaron Kynard (Tammy) and his parents Lawrence and Pearlia Kynard, whom he loved with all his heart.
